Optimization of W5 fault block surface-active polymer flooding scheme

Abstract

According to the current situation of the W5 fault block, it is necessary to carry out the surface-active polymer flooding. By physical simulation, the optimal concentration is 1000 mg/L, the optimal slug size is 0.3PV, and the earlier the injection opportunity, the slower the injection rate, the higher the recovery rate. By numerical simulation, the recovery rate of the optimal scheme is 27.2%. Compared with the water flooding, the cumulative oil increase is 3.33 × 104 t, the enhanced oil recovery is 5.74%, the oil-enhancing amount of one ton surface-active polymers is 307.73 t/t, and the ratio of output to input is 16.30.
